They're very good. My hubby wasnt crazy about them but I thought they were very good to be 147 cals and 18 grams of protein per muffin.

If looking at food can make you gain weight, I gained 3 lbs just looking at the pictures! Yummmm! :P

I have done those as well as the buffalo chicken Pasta muffins, enchilada cupcakes are my fav., I have also had the zucchini tots and the zucchini squares - both are super tasty. Have made chicken parm. casserole and layered pasta bake. Have not had a fail from that website yet. All the muffin tin ones can be frozen and are great for lunches.

I may try the chicken piccata tomorrow.

  • Author

Wild rosé what website are you finding those on?

www.emilybites.com They have the nutritonal info on most of the recipes as well as WW points.
